tool

WinDbg

WinDbg is a powerful debugger for Windows operating systems, developed by Microsoft, used for analyzing and troubleshooting system crashes, application failures, and performance issues. It supports kernel-mode and user-mode debugging, memory analysis, and reverse engineering, often employed for low-level diagnostics and security research.

Also known as: Windows Debugger, WinDbg Preview, Microsoft Debugger, KD, NTSD
🧊Why learn WinDbg?

Developers should learn WinDbg when working on Windows-based applications or drivers that require deep debugging, such as diagnosing blue screen errors (BSODs), analyzing memory dumps, or investigating security vulnerabilities. It is essential for system programmers, security analysts, and IT professionals who need to understand Windows internals and resolve complex issues that standard debuggers cannot handle.

Compare WinDbg

Learning Resources

Related Tools

Alternatives to WinDbg